Garden Tour of Rough Point: Caring for Doris Duke's Legacy Garden
When: Sunday, June 21st from 4:00 - 5:00 PM
Location: Rough Point Museum, 680 Bellevue Avenue, Newport
Doris Duke’s legacy gardens reflect her interest in sustainable horticulture and environmental conservation. Join us on this interactive guided tour of the Formal Garden and the Kitchen Garden with the NRF Gardener, a unique working educational garden that provides produce for our community partners. Learn about the history of the gardens, how NRF cares for the gardens today, and get insights into your own gardening practices.
Know before you go: This tour will take place outdoors (rain or shine) and requires walking on uneven ground. Unfortunately, the grounds are not currently wheelchair accessible.

About Telling Stories - Guided Tours:
Telling Stories: Guided Tours at NRF goes deeper into the legacy of Doris Duke through the exploration of her life—including how her work preserving, restoring, and sharing Newport’s cultural heritage impacts us today. Each tour takes a closer look at the people behind the places and collections we care for.
